logo

Output f381b1a570516d30f7cf3aaa0a5f6a8acab5df0e05ffaa3ee3121a212004cf32:0

value
752778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 714cbbe0f4c934aa458f6f53eb7bde1359642c60 OP_EQUAL
address
3C26CnWkahc2dxxueKP8CEsSANn2WWwkdP
transaction
f381b1a570516d30f7cf3aaa0a5f6a8acab5df0e05ffaa3ee3121a212004cf32